Mahmoud of Ghazni, who she calls Mohamed of Ghazni, and numerous "Muslim rulers" who invaded India at one time or another, were not driven by a missionary zeal to convert the subcontinent to Islam. They were merely greedy kings and conquerors like hundreds of others who came to India for its fabled riches.

Be it Mahmoud of Ghazni or Mohammed Ghouri, who invaded India 17 times, were merely men driven by a craving for power, not by a holy mission to spread Islam. They just happened to be Muslims - just like some European and Indian conquerors happened to be Christian or Hindu.

Just as Ashoka the Great was not driven by any religious zeal when he painted Kalinga red with the blood of its people, Muslim conquerors were not on a proselytizing mission.

This is why they were equally ruthless in dealing with fellow Muslims. What Babar did to Ibrahim Khilji and what Sher Shah Suri did to Humayun is what emperors and kings routinely did to each other - and not just in India.

Nadir Shah of Iran, who Rajiva says watched from the ramparts of Delhi while the 'infidels' were killed, did not kill only Hindus. If this is any consolation, almost all of those killed in Delhi at the time were Muslim subjects of the reigning King Mohammed Shah.

If Muslim rulers fought and killed Hindu kings and their subjects, they also killed their fellow Muslim rulers and their subjects with equal impunity. Mogul Emperor Aurangzeb incarcerated and killed his own father and brothers.

All this was for power and the religion of these rulers had nothing to do with the whole circus. Even the most benign of Muslim emperors like Akbar did not represent Islam or Muslims, just as most of the current lot of Muslim rulers do not.

If these men had indeed been real models of Islam and its teachings, their subjects would have thanked them as the persecuted Jews did when the second Caliph Omar entered Jerusalem or as the oppressed Christians did when Tareq bin Ziad led the Muslim army into Spain.

As for the charge of forcing the Hindus to convert to Islam, there's a simple answer to the accusation. If the Muslims had indeed converted the indigenous population at sword's point, India would have been a Muslim country today, which is not the case. The Muslims are still a minority in the country of a billion. The same would have been true of Spain. Remember, both India and Spain were ruled by the Muslims for nearly a thousand years.
